calamites |ˌkaləˈmʌɪtiːz | ▶noun ( pl. same ) a swamp plant with jointed stems that belonged to an extinct group related to the horsetails, growing to a height of 18 m (60 ft ). ●Calamites and other genera, family Calamitaceae, class Sphenopsida. ORIGIN modern Latin, from calamus .
